Market Analysis
In the affordable starter segment of Redwater, homebuyers tend to be young families, first-time buyers, and professionals looking for a quieter lifestyle while remaining connected to urban amenities. Many are drawn to the community for its family-friendly atmosphere and active lifestyle options. Redwater offers a blend of small-town charm with easy access to larger cities like Fort Saskatchewan and Edmonton, making it appealing to those seeking a balance between work and leisure. The local schools, such as Redwater School and St. Matthias Catholic School, are a big draw for families, contributing to the demand for detached homes in this market segment. The lifestyle in Redwater is characterized by outdoor activities and community involvement. Residents enjoy access to parks like the scenic Redwater Park, which features walking trails and playgrounds, fostering a sense of community and outdoor enjoyment. With a steady influx of new residents, Redwater continues to attract individuals looking for spacious homes without the high price tag typically found in larger urban centers.
Price Insights
In Redwater, buyers in the $0 to $500,000 price range enjoy a diverse selection of detached homes. The median price of $154,900 and the average price of $226,971 ensure that many homes are affordable while offering substantial living space and proximity to amenities. For example, a budget of $250,000 can secure a well-maintained 3-bedroom bungalow on streets like 50 Avenue or 49 Street, featuring a spacious yard and easy access to local schools and parks. Investors and first-time homebuyers appreciate that homes in this segment often include desirable features such as updated kitchens, large backyards, and even basements, providing flexibility for future renovations or expansion. As a result, this market segment is ideal for those prioritizing both affordability and comfort, enabling families to settle into their new homes without stretching their budgets.

Detached homes in Redwater are characterized by their spacious layouts and family-oriented designs. Many properties feature ample square footage, often exceeding 1,000 square feet, with styles ranging from charming bungalows to two-storey houses, catering to a variety of tastes. The typical lot sizes provide generous outdoor spaces, perfect for children to play or for gardening enthusiasts. Most homes also come equipped with essential amenities such as basements, garages, and large yards, which are particularly appealing for families and those looking to personalize their space. With many properties located on quiet streets like 52 Avenue and 46 Street, homebuyers can expect a peaceful environment conducive to family living and relaxation.
